Blatant Labour-Plaid government electioneering shameful - Eleanor Burnham

Commenting on the multi-million pound investment in coastal tourism
projects by the Welsh government Heritage Minister during a General
election campaign, Eleanor Burnham, Welsh Lib Dem Shadow Heritage
Minister said:

"While this money for coastal tourism projects is welcomed, the timing
of this announcement is blatant electioneering from the Labour-Plaid
government.

"Why have they waited until the election to announce this money? People
will see straight though this stunt and the Labour and Plaid Cymru
government should have more respect for the people of Wales. Their votes
cannot be bought by electioneering stunts like this.

"If sweetening the people of Wales with their own money is the best way
they can attract votes, this proves that Labour and Plaid have nothing
to offer".
